About Amazon
 Amazon Inc. is an American international E-commerce company.
 It was started by Jeffrey P. Bezos in the year 1994.
 It is a largest online retailer.
 When many companies were not able to survive during the 90`s Amazon managed
to survive and successful now.
 Buying suggestions based on your search.
 IT is the 11th most searched sit around the world.
 Amazon also acquired many about to close .com companies like IMDB, buyVip,
Lexcycle, CDnow and Pets.com etc .

Generic Business Strategy

Amazon is placed in the Overall Cost leadership quadrant and its relentless
focus on costs is the key to understanding its overall strategy
The specific measures taken by Amazon in pursuit of this strategy include
steep discounts for its regular members through the:
 Amazon prime program
 Ensuring timely and even express delivery and its at times
 Waiving off the shipping charges
 Passing on the benefits of avoiding state taxes to the customer.

Response to COVID-19 Pandemic
 Hazard pay and overtime
A temporary $2-per-hour rise in pay

 Additional hiring as a result of pandemic


hired some 100,000 more staff in the US to help deal with essential items such as food
and medical equipment
 Employee protests during COVID-19
Jeff Bezos announced that Amazon expects to spend $4 billion or more on COVID-19-
related issues: personal protective equipment, higher wages for hourly teams, cleaning for
facilities, and expanding Amazon's COVID-19 testing capabilities.

In January 2021, Amazon invested with over $278 million by opening two new
centers in Italy (Novara and Modena) and creating over 1100 jobs.
